Charles Sansom was born from the union of the late, Charlie and Patsy Sansom on December 18, 1966 in Dallas Texas. In the spring of 1973, his mom got saved and filled with the Holy Ghost at Full Gospel Holy Temple Inc. under the leadership of Apostle Lobias Murray. When God saved her, she hit the floor running for Jesus and she instilled the love of Christ in her little ones. The oldest of five, Charles, began to watch her life and was filled with the Holy Ghost at the age of 8 years old. Even as a young boy in the second grade, he felt the call of God on his life and began to try to sway his classmates to accept Christ in their lives. Years later, former classmates still tell stories of him carrying a bible to school and warning the classmates of hell fire destruction. He loved to preach in the mirror at a young age and asked God to become a preacher someday. This call would soon be answered at the age of 20 years old. In 1989, he moved to Sacramento, California to help his cousin start his church and later was licensed by Bishop J.R. Willis of the Foundation of Faith Church of God in Christ (C.O.G.l.C.) In 1993, he relocated to Washington D.C. area and eventually joined Faith Temple #2 Original Free Will Baptist Church {OFWB) and was ordained under the Middle Eastern OFWB Annual Conference under his pastor, Bishop L.N. Forbes. He worked as an assistant Sunday school teacher, assisted with the youth and the Brother Hood ministry and was a foreign missionary to Haiti. In 2004, he met the love of his life, Shagala Curtis and changed his membership to City of Hope International Worship Centre in Laurel, MD under the leadership of Bishop Joseph Mccargo. During that time their beloved daughter Rebekah was born. He worked in various capacities of his church, such as Sunday School teacher for the elementary age level, the Brother Hood Ministry and wherever needed. In July of 2012, Charles felt the call of God to evangelize in the community.  He began to do outreach to his neighbors and from this an in- home bible study was formed. With much urging from the members of the bible study and the pull of God on his life, Charles with the assistance of his devoted wife began to pursue God for direction in starting a church.  Under the leadership and guidance of the Lord and his

spiritual oversight, Bishop McCargo, Charles established Higher Height Praise Centre Inc. The church name was given to him l5 years prior, when the Lord spoke to him and said that he would pastor many. Today, Charles and Higher Heights Praise Centre stand as evidence of the fulfillment of God's word in his life.  In 2017 Higher Heights Praise Centre joined the Citywide Pastor’s Crusade Association, a network of churches and is now under the spiritual oversight of Bishop Allen Harris of Norfolk, VA.
